Tx Short Random Range |
(Conventional Wide, ASTRO Data) |
![]()
Selects the maximum amount of time that the radio waits to transmit once the first qualified Frame Sync Sequence has been received indicating that the channel is clear. The radio randomly checks channel access status based on this maximum wait time. This selection applies for all ASTRO type Conventional Systems. Time is in milliseconds.
![]()
|
Increasing this value reduces the potential of collision with other radios attempting to transmit data (seize the channel), but it also increases the channel access delay. |
